Product Specifications

ParameterValue
Product Name5-Amino-4-Imidazolecarboxamide
CAS Number360-97-4
Purity>99%
StateSolid
Molecular FormulaC4h6n4o
Boiling Point535.4±60.0 °c at 760 Mmhg
Melting Point164-170 °c(Lit.)
Packing25kgs
Transport Packageby Foil - Alum Bag or Paper Drum
Specification250kg/drum Or 1, 250kg/IBC
HS Code2934999090
Production Capacity20t/Year

Typical Industrial Applications

As a key chemical synthesis raw material, 5-Amino-4-Imidazolecarboxamide (CAS 360-97-4) finds extensive use in pharmaceutical intermediate synthesis, specialty chemical production, and advanced material research. Its high purity and stable molecular structure make it particularly valuable in processes requiring precise reaction control and minimal impurity interference.

Storage & Handling

  • Store in a cool, dry, well-ventilated area, sealed and away from direct sunlight.
  • Keep away from incompatible materials, food and feed sources.
  • Handle with appropriate personal protective equipment (gloves, goggles, lab coat).
  • Follow good industrial hygiene practices. Avoid inhalation and skin contact.
  • Refer to MSDS for detailed storage and safety instructions.
